The Saint James Croquet Association in Saint James, North Carolina, has launched a new collection of interactive online croquet tools and virtual games designed to help players learn, practice and stay engaged with the sport. Originally developed for SJCA members, the tools are publicly available through the club’s new website for any croquet player interested in exploring shot planning, angles, tactics or virtual play.
A new independent platform is changing how players, fans and administrators explore the competitive world of Golf Croquet. Created by North Toronto Croquet Club member Adam Barr, GCrankings.com transforms World Croquet Federation (WCF) rankings and results data into a comprehensive analytics platform that offers unprecedented insight into the international game. Combining interactive dashboards, historical data, player profiles and advanced statistical tools, the site represents one of the most significant developments in croquet data analysis to date.
The 2026 Mallet Series Tour season is underway following the Indian Territory Open in Tulsa, Oklahoma, where Oklahoma City's Scott Spradling turned in a dominant performance to capture the Championship Flight title and take the early lead in the Pro Series standings.

Beverley Cardo made her first visit to the Bald Head Island Croquet Club in North Carolina to lead the inaugural Bev’s Boot Camp program from March 31 to April 2. The program is part of her presidential initiative to increase competitive American Six Wicket play among women. The event was held on Bald Head Island’s three new courts, with Cardo on hand to represent the USCA at the ribbon-cutting ceremony.

The 2026 Mallet Series Tour schedule continues to expand with the addition of major tournaments representing both American Six-Wicket and Golf Croquet competition across the United States. Among the featured events on the 2026 calendar is the Indian Territory Open in Tulsa, Oklahoma, which joins the tour as an American Six-Wicket event scheduled for Memorial Day weekend. The tournament, which runs May 22-25, has become one of the region’s most established competitive events and strengthens the tour’s multi-code structure.

The 2026 Canadian Association Croquet National Championship was held June 4-7 in Bayfield, Ontario, bringing together many of the best association croquet players from across Canada and abroad. The championship was jointly hosted at the Bayfield International Croquet Club with support by the Seaforth Lawn Bowling Club.
